Bus jammed in Foyle Street causing traffic disruption

Traffic is currently at a standstill in Derry's Foyle Street, one of the city's main thoroughfares. 

A Feda O'Donnell coach has become jammed at the pedestrian entrance to the Foyle Street bus depot, just below the Blackbird pub.

The bus is blocking the whole street, which is impassible at the minute. 

It is probably advisable to avoid the area completely until the situation is resolved, hopefully sooner rather than later.
